Married at First Sight: The Tycoon Spoils Me Rotten Plot:
Office worker Su Xiaonuan gets tricked into a flash marriage with cold-hearted tycoon Gu Tingchen. What starts as a contractual arrangement turns into a whirlwind romance as the CEO showers her with luxury gifts and homemade meals. But when Su discovers dark secrets behind their marriage, she must choose between love and the truth.
